Comment 1 Denis Fateyev 2020-06-24 22:49:13 UTC
The package "perl-Devel-CheckLib" isn't provided in actual EPEL branches any more.
Starting from RHEL7 and above, it's included to the base repository, and cannot be overridden or updated in terms of EPEL.

In theory, you can discuss the package version bump addressing RedHat customer service (there were cases in the past when various packages versions were bumped) — but you need really strong reasons for that to get through this process. In any case, this issue cannot be solved in EPEL now.
